Howard Zehr's Three Pillars of Restorative Justice.

Focusing on identifying harms, needs and obligations restorative justice enagages key stakeholders in making things right.  All parties are treated with respect, accountability and healing are utilized to 'make things right'.

  • Research has shown victims are more satisfied with the restorative justice than the traditional court process.
  • Victims are less likely to feel like they will be revictimized following Restorative Justice programs.
  • Offenders that meet face to face with a victim are less likely to reoffend.
  • Restorative Justice in schools has demonstrated fewer detentions, suspensions and incidents of violence.
  • Restorative schools report and increased sense of community and improve student teacher relationships
